fig3.7
#include<iostream>
#include<string>
using namespace std;
class GradeBook
{
public:
explicit GradeBook(string name)
:courseName(name)
{
}
void setCourseName(string name)
{
courseName = name;
}
string getCourseName() const
{
return courseName;
}
void disPlayMessage() const
{
cout << "Welcome to the grade book for\n" << getCourseName()
<< "!" << endl;
}
private:
string courseName;
};
int main()
{
GradeBook gradeBook1("cs101 Introduction to c++ programming");
GradeBook gradeBook2("cs102 Data Structures in c++");
cout << "gradeBook1 creat for course: " << gradeBook1.getCourseName()
<< "\ngradeBook2 creat for course: " << gradeBook2.getCourseName()
<< endl;
system("pause");
return 0;
}